lang/common-lisp: revise sly popup rules
Fixes issues with the compilation, inspector, debug or trace buffers replacing the repl popup.
This commit is contained in:
parent
5b807a1c72
commit
f54c36e721
1 changed files with 7 additions and 1 deletions
|
@ -3,7 +3,13 @@
|
||||||
(after! sly
|
(after! sly
|
||||||
(setq inferior-lisp-program "sbcl")
|
(setq inferior-lisp-program "sbcl")
|
||||||
|
|
||||||
(set-popup-rule! "^\\*sly" :quit nil :ttl nil)
|
(set-popup-rules!
|
||||||
|
'(("^\\*sly-mrepl" :vslot 2 :quit nil :ttl nil)
|
||||||
|
("^\\*sly-db" :vslot 3 :quit nil :ttl nil)
|
||||||
|
("^\\*sly-compilation" :vslot 4 :ttl nil)
|
||||||
|
("^\\*sly-inspector" :vslot 5 :ttl nil)
|
||||||
|
("^\\*sly-traces" :vslot 6 :ttl nil)))
|
||||||
|
|
||||||
(set-repl-handler! 'lisp-mode #'sly-mrepl)
|
(set-repl-handler! 'lisp-mode #'sly-mrepl)
|
||||||
(set-lookup-handlers! 'lisp-mode
|
(set-lookup-handlers! 'lisp-mode
|
||||||
:definition #'sly-edit-definition
|
:definition #'sly-edit-definition
|
||||||
|
|
Loading…
Add table
Add a link
Reference in a new issue